A former Manchester schoolboy has directed his first film in Nigeria's Nollywood.
Mathew Alajogun made The Cleanser, which involves corrupt politicians being assassinated, in the city of Ibadan.
Popularly known as Nollywood, Nigeria's film industry is the world's second largest producer of movies behind Bollywood in India.
